Output 84de885b085768b6b17a377660a489f5e2045245bb0136068024e2f7db6968b2:1

value
509417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f1bf3e8675b3d30004d395574a624020301a86 OP_EQUAL
address
3DuFPwGotyBaCBNurEnPAitbBA8iSncmAk
transaction
84de885b085768b6b17a377660a489f5e2045245bb0136068024e2f7db6968b2
spent
true